The Xiaomi Pad 6 standard version comes with a single rear camera lens with 13 megapixels and a front 8-megapixel selfie lens. On the other hand, the Xiaomi Pad 6 Pro features a 50-megapixel main camera with a 2-megapixel depth of field lens and a 20-megapixel centered selfie lens. The cameras on both devices allow for high-quality pictures and videos. Another key difference between the two tablets is their fast charging capabilities. The Xiaomi Pad 6 comes with an 8840mAh battery and supports 33W fast charging, taking approximately 99 minutes to reach 100%. Meanwhile, the Xiaomi Pad 6 Pro is equipped with an 8600mAh battery and supports 67W fast charging, taking just 62 minutes to reach 100%. charging features that are efficient and convenient. In terms of security, the Xiaomi Pad 6 supports face unlock, while the Xiaomi Pad 6 Pro offers an additional side fingerprint unlock. The Pro version’s fingerprint sensor is integrated with the power button, providing a seamless and convenient experience for users. Both tablets come with LPDDR5 + UFS 3.1 storage and four speakers, supporting Dolby Atmos. They also have four microphones, a USB 3.2 Gen1 interface that supports DP output, and a thickness of just 6.51mm, making them incredibly portable. The operating system for both devices is MIUI Pad14.

The smartphone is fueled by a Non-removable Li-Po 5000 mAh battery + 10W wired. The phone runs on the Android 12 (Go edition) + MIUI operating system providing smooth operation of the device. It supports Dual SIM (Nano-SIM, dual stand-by). The device is available in different colors like Light Green, Light Blue, and Black. The smartphone is powered by the Mediatek Helio G36 Octa-core processor while the GPU is PowerVR GE8320. The rear camera consists of an 8 MP (wide) + 0.08 MP (depth) sensor lenses while the front camera has a 5 MP sensor. The smartphone comes in 6.52 inches size and the display is IPS LCD touchscreen that provides 720 x 1600 pixels resolution. Xiaomi Redmi A2+ is equipped with accelerometer sensor and it features Type-C USB, GPS with A-GPS, GLONASS, GALILEO, BDS, and Bluetooth 5.0. It is packed 2 GB, 3 GB RAM and 32 GB internal storage.

The Xiaomi 11 Lite 5G NE is a mid-range smartphone that features a 6.55-inch FHD+ AMOLED display with a 90Hz refresh rate, 64MP + 8MP + 5MP triple rear cameras, and a 20MP selfie camera in a thin and light body. It runs on Qualcomm Snapdragon 778G chipset with either 6GB or 8GB of RAM and MIUI 12.5 software. There's also a side-mounted fingerprint scanner, 5G connectivity, an infrared remote function, dual speakers, and up to 256GB of expandable storage. A 4,250mAh battery powers the device with support for 33W fast charging technology.
